Output deb2d695a9e31dd85f8a751b42edf7480fa4bc3a54079246a2ec7ea18f282deb:0

value
547314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d2e3729de79489b657615085a592bdc6f26084f OP_EQUALVERIFY OP_CHECKSIG
address
13fHxfvcTEMbj3xNfbCYjsmAB636HgtUcX
transaction
deb2d695a9e31dd85f8a751b42edf7480fa4bc3a54079246a2ec7ea18f282deb
confirmations
369330
spent
true